What affects the price

Cleaning costs depend on a few specific things regarding your fireplace setup. We look at the total height of the chimney, the number of flues, and how much creosote buildup has accumulated over time. If your chimney has been neglected for several seasons, or if there are blockages like animal nests or heavy debris, the labor required increases. What does a professional chimney sweep actually do in Boston?

A professional chimney sweep in Boston inspects your entire system, from the damper to the cap. They meticulously remove creosote, soot, and debris that can cause fires. This process also involves checking for cracks, loose bricks, or obstructions like bird nests. Ensuring proper ventilation is key to preventing smoke from entering your home. A clean chimney is a safe chimney.

How often should I have my chimney swept in Boston?

In Boston, it's generally recommended to have your chimney swept annually. This is especially true if you use your fireplace regularly during the colder months. Annual inspections help detect potential issues early and prevent dangerous creosote accumulation. Even if you use your fireplace infrequently, a yearly check is advisable for safety.
